Author: Andrew Knight
Andrew Knight is Vice Dean for Education & Globalization and Professor of Organizational Behavior in the Olin Business School at Washington University in St. Louis. Knight’s research and teaching address leadership, teamwork, and people analytics, with a special focus on the contexts of healthcare and entrepreneurship.
Before joining Washington University in St. Louis, Knight led research and product development at Pascal Metrics Inc.—a provider of risk analytics in healthcare—from its founding through 2010. He is an alumnus of the University of Dayton (BA in Psychology and Spanish), the University of Maryland (MA in Industrial-Organizational Psychology), and the University of Pennsylvania’s Wharton School (MS, PhD in Managerial Science and Applied Economics).
